Course Numbering System
A course's level of instruction is shown by the number assigned to it:
| Course |
|
| Number |
Type of Course |
| 1 to 99 |
Preparatory and remedial (noncredit) |
| 100 to 299 |
Lower-division |
| 300 to 499 |
Upper-division |
| 500 to 599 |
Advanced undergraduate or graduate |
| 600 to 799 |
Graduate |
Credit-Hour Designations
One semester hour of credit represents a minimum of one hour of
instruction per week in a semester or two hours of instruction per
week in a term (e.g., a three-hour class will meet at least three
hours per week). The three-number code that appears in
parentheses immediately after each course title has the following
significance:
| First number |
Semester hours of credit |
| Second number |
Class hours of lecture, recitation, or seminar
meeting per week |
| Third number |
Laboratory hours required per week or hours
of field study or individual research per
week, beyond the hours shown in the second
number |
Abbreviations and Symbols
Course Listings
The following abbreviations and symbols are used in the course
listings:
| A,B |
Indicate parts of a course to be taken in separate
enrollments. |
| Arr. |
Credit, class, or laboratory hours arranged |
| ea. |
Credit-hour designation applies to each registration |
| M |
Majors-only course |
| R |
Designates a course that may be repeated for credit.
Two R courses with the same number on a transcript
are treated as two independent courses. An R course
cannot be repeated to raise the grade received; all
grades will be counted because it is assumed that the
subject matter varies from time to time. |
